Which sentence follows correct grammatical conventions? ) • The crow in that bush squawk loudly at the hawks. The crows in that bush squawks loudly at the hawks. The crows in that bush squawk loudly at the hawks. The crow in that bushes squawks loudly at the hawks.

toga:

The sentence that follows correct grammatical conventions is: c. The crows in that bush squawk loudly at the hawks.

What is grammatical conventions

toga:

Grammatical conventions refer to the standard rules and practices that govern language usage, including rules for punctuation, capitalization, spelling, and sentence structure. These conventions help ensure that written communication is clear, consistent, and easily understood by readers.
